GetAbsolutePathName Method

Returns a complete and unambiguous path from a provided path specification.



Required. Always the name of a FileSystemObject.


Required. Path specification to change to a complete and unambiguous path.

A path is complete and unambiguous if it provides a complete reference from the root of the specified drive. A complete path can only end with a path separator character (\) if it specifies the root folder of a mapped drive.

Assuming the current directory is c:\mydocuments\reports, the following table illustrates the behavior of the GetAbsolutePathName method.

pathspec (JScript)

pathspec (VBScript)

Returned path



















The following example illustrates the use of the GetAbsolutePathName method.

function ShowAbsolutePath(path)
   var fso, s= "";
   fso = new ActiveXObject("Scripting.FileSystemObject");
   s += fso.GetAbsolutePathName(path);

Function ShowAbsolutePath(path)
   Dim fso
   Set fso = CreateObject("Scripting.FileSystemObject")
   ShowAbsolutePath = fso.GetAbsolutePathName(path)
End Function